Job Duties

  • address guests by name and respond to their requests ensuring complete service
  • assist servers with menu presentation and answer questions about food and beverages
  • prepare food baskets with condiments and sides verifying order accuracy and presentation
  • maintain cleanliness and organization in kitchen and café areas
  • monitor supplies and stock levels to support service efficiency
  • communicate kitchen times and relay information to servers and management
  • complete daily and weekly checklists and perform other duties as assigned
